Where Do Google Dictionary Definitions Come From?

Where Do Google Dictionary Definitions Come From? As of 2018 Google licenses dictionary data from OxfordDictionaries.com for multiple languages such as British/American English, Spanish and French among others (see below). How Do You Cite A Definition From A Website In MLA?

How Do You Cite A Definition From A Website In MLA? Author’s Last Name, First Name. “Title of Entry.” Title of Encyclopedia or Dictionary, Publication or Update Date, Name of Website. URL. Can You Cite Google Dictionary?

Can You Cite Google Dictionary? Can you cite Google Dictionary? Don’t cite Google as a dictionary. Google has licensed two of the dictionaries from Oxford Languages for their search product: The Oxford Dictionary of English. How Do I Quote A Dictionary Definition In My Essay?

How Do I Quote A Dictionary Definition In My Essay? To cite a definition within the text, you would place the defined word and the date of publication in parentheses after the relevant phrase and before the punctuation mark.
